Reserves Policies
Materials which must be used by students in order to complete course
requirements may be placed on library reserve. Please limit reserve materials
to required reading as there are shelving limitations in the reserve area.
Reserve materials are shelved on closed stacks behind the Main Level
Circulation Desk. Time on reserve items is designated by the instructor.
Any deviation from an instructor's designated circulation period will be
done only with the consent of that instructor.
The following suggestions will increase the effectiveness of the
reserve collection :

The form for placing materials on reserve is available in the library.
-
Order new books that you will want for reserve several months in advance
of their need.
-
Within reason and copyright restrictions, copies of periodical or newspaper
articles will be placed on reserve. According to copyright restrictions,
a photocopied article may be used for reserve one semester one time only.
For reuse, permission must be granted from the copyright owner and a copy
of the permission letter given t o the library.
-
Personal copies will be placed on reserve at your request. These items
will be given the same care library materials receive. However, there is
no guarantee against loss or damage.
-
Items will be placed on reserve on a first - come basis. Please allow
at least 48 hours for the library staff to process the materials for the
reserve shelves.

Be sure that the library has placed your items on reserve before you
assign these items to your class.
At the end of each semester, all library materials are returned to regular
shelving and personal copies are returned to the respective faculty member
unless it has been requested that they remain on reserve.
